Abstract

The processes of ignition and combustion of an electric arc during the formation of hardening composite coatings by the method of carbide vibro-arc hardening (CVAH) are investigated. It is established that an increase in the electric field intensity during CVAH can be achieved by minimizing the acceleration of the carbon electrode during its oscillations. The rational mode of the CVAH is determined. Keywords: composite coating, carbide vibro-arc hardening, arc ignition, combustion, carbon electrode, intensity, multicomponent paste.
